About This Book

Did you know animals can catch colds and sniffles just like you? From sneezing squirrels to coughing cats, these creatures feel under the weather—but that’s only the beginning.

Quick Assessment

This rhyming story introduces young children to various animals experiencing common illnesses in a gentle, approachable way. Perfect for early readers aged 5 to 8, it helps normalize sickness and encourages empathy without scary details. The simple text and colorful illustrations make it engaging and age-appropriate for beginning readers.
